Mr. Lemanski is survived by two sons, Stanley Lemanski, Minden City, and Leo Lemanski, Ubly; three daughters, Mrs Floyd O'Parka, Ubly, and Mrs, William Block and Mrs. August Abraham Jr., both of Minden City; 16 grandchildren, 26 great grandchildren and a brother, Joseph Lemanski, Ubly.
Funeral services will be conducted at 9 a.m. Monday in St. Mary's church by Rev. Ignatious Woloszyk. Burial will be in the church cemetery. The remains are in Zinger Funeral Home, Ubly, where the Rosary will be recited at 8 p.m. Sunday. Published Port Huron Times Herald Saturday August 7, 1965
